Toyota's New RAV4 is Set to Arrive Sooner Than Expected

A fresh look, upgraded tech, and more efficient hybrid powertrains are on the way — but don't expect a complete reinvention of America's best-selling vehicle.
A familiar platform with a fresh face
Toyota's next-generation RAV4 is just around the corner, and while the brand is keeping things close to the chest, new teaser images and a confirmed reveal date of May 21 suggest the wait won't be long. The bestselling SUV in America is due for an update, and Toyota's playing it smart: expect evolutionary styling changes, enhanced hybrid performance, and an interior that borrows from the tech-forward Prius.
Even though Toyota is branding this RAV4 as 'all-new,' it's really more of a heavy refresh. The SUV will continue riding on the same TNGA-K platform introduced with the fifth-gen model in 2018. Think of it like what Toyota just did with the new Camry — revamped looks and tech, but the bones remain the same.

Hybrid powertrain, smarter efficiency
Under the hood, the next RAV4 is expected to stick with Toyota's proven 2.5-liter hybrid setup but with added power and better fuel efficiency. The base hybrid is expected to deliver around 225 hp in front-wheel drive and up to 232 hp with all-wheel drive, thanks to an additional rear-mounted motor. A plug-in hybrid version — likely a new take on the RAV4 Prime — will follow.
There's also speculation about a fully electric model joining the lineup, possibly using an improved version of the TNGA-K platform, though Toyota hasn't confirmed those plans yet. One thing's clear: Toyota's betting big on hybrids over full electrics for now.
Tech-heavy interior inspired by Prius
Leaked photos from Toyota Europe give us a good look at the interior, and it's clear the next RAV4 is taking cues from the latest Prius. Expect a cleaner, more modern cabin featuring a freestanding digital instrument cluster and a prominent infotainment screen mounted high on the center stack.

Toyota is also focusing on premium touches like better materials, wireless phone charging, and possibly even a head-up display. The redesigned center console hints at a more driver-centric layout, and while overall dimensions likely won't change much, the space should feel more upscale.
Styling tweaks and a possible TRD Pro
Outside, the 2026 RAV4 leans into Toyota's new design language with wraparound LED daytime running lights, a squared-off grille, and subtle aerodynamic upgrades. The shape is still instantly recognizable, but the details are sharper.

There's also talk of Toyota launching a more rugged TRD Pro trim, especially as Honda prepares to roll out a TrailSport version of the CR-V. With Toyota's off-road heritage and growing demand for adventure-ready SUVs, it would be a smart move.
Final thoughts
The RAV4's official debut is just days away, and Toyota fans won't have to wait long to see it on the road as sales are expected to begin this fall. Despite growing competition from Mazda, Honda, Hyundai, and others, the RAV4's blend of reliability, practicality, and hybrid efficiency continues to make it a powerhouse in the compact SUV segment. It may not be revolutionary, but the next RAV4 looks ready to hold its crown.

Google Pixel 10 Pro XL: The 10 Most Important Changes

The Google Pixel 10 Pro XL introduces a range of advancements designed to elevate the flagship smartphone experience. With notable improvements in AI capabilities, camera technology, and hardware performance, this device aims to cater to both tech enthusiasts and everyday users. Below, we explore the ten most impactful upgrades that set this model apart from its predecessors. The video below from TechTalkTV gives us more details on the new Google Pixel 10 XL before its official launch next week. Watch this video on YouTube. 1. Advanced Camera Innovations The Pixel 10 Pro XL redefines smartphone photography with its upgraded camera system. The ProRes zoom now supports up to 100x magnification, a significant leap from the 30x limit of the Pixel 9 Pro. This enhancement allows you to capture distant subjects with remarkable clarity, making it a standout feature for photography enthusiasts. Additionally, the new 'Camera Coach' AI tool provides real-time guidance to help you take better photos, whether you're capturing landscapes, portraits, or action shots. The introduction of the 'teley macro' mode, which combines telephoto and macro capabilities, adds versatility for close-up photography. These innovations position the Pixel 10 Pro XL as a top choice for users seeking professional-grade photography in a smartphone. 2. Magnetic Wireless Charging Wireless charging becomes more efficient and user-friendly with the Pixel 10 Pro XL's built-in magnets. This feature ensures a secure connection between the phone and the charging pad, eliminating alignment issues and the need for specialized cases. Supporting 26 W wireless charging, the device offers faster and more reliable power delivery compared to its predecessor. This improvement enhances convenience, particularly for users who rely on wireless charging in their daily routines. 3. Smarter AI Assistant: Magic Q Google introduces 'Magic Q,' an AI-powered assistant designed to simplify your daily tasks. By analyzing your habits and context, Magic Q can suggest apps, adjust settings, and remind you of important events. This feature automates routine activities, saving you time and effort. Pixel Pro users also benefit from a one-year subscription to Google AI Pro, which includes access to Gemini Pro and 2 TB of cloud storage. These additions enhance the overall user experience, making the Pixel 10 Pro XL a valuable tool for productivity and organization. 4. Dual eSIM Technology The Pixel 10 Pro XL embraces dual eSIM technology, allowing you to manage two phone numbers without the need for physical SIM cards. While a SIM tray may still be available in certain regions, this shift reflects the growing adoption of eSIM technology across the industry. For frequent travelers or users managing multiple lines, this feature offers greater convenience and flexibility, eliminating the hassle of swapping SIM cards. 5. Increased Battery Capacity With a 5200 mAh battery, the Pixel 10 Pro XL features the largest battery ever featured in a Pixel device. Despite the increased capacity, Google maintains its claim of 24+ hours of battery life, making sure reliable performance throughout the day. While actual battery life will vary based on usage patterns and software optimization, this upgrade provides added peace of mind for users who rely heavily on their devices. 6. Tensor G5 Chipset At the heart of the Pixel 10 Pro XL is the Tensor G5 chipset, engineered to enhance AI-driven tasks and overall performance. While it may not rival competitors like Qualcomm in raw processing power, the Tensor G5 excels in machine learning and everyday functionality. This ensures a smooth and responsive user experience, particularly for features that use AI, such as Magic Q and Camera Coach. 7. Enhanced Display Technology The Pixel 10 Pro XL features a display with a 480 Hz PWM (Pulse Width Modulation) refresh rate, doubling the standard of its predecessor. This improvement reduces eye strain during prolonged use and delivers smoother visuals, meeting the expectations of premium smartphone users. The result is a more comfortable and immersive viewing experience, whether you're streaming videos, gaming, or browsing. 8. Expanded Storage Options Google has expanded the storage configurations for the Pixel 10 Pro XL, offering options ranging from 256 GB to 1 TB. The removal of the 128 GB tier reflects a focus on meeting the needs of users who require more space for apps, photos, and videos. Whether you're a casual user or a content creator, these options provide greater flexibility and ensure that you have ample storage for your digital content. 9. Faster Charging Speeds The Pixel 10 Pro XL supports 39 W wired charging, a modest improvement over its predecessor. While not a new change, this upgrade reduces charging time, making sure that your device is ready when you need it. Combined with the enhanced wireless charging capabilities, the Pixel 10 Pro XL delivers a more efficient and convenient power management experience. 10. Pricing and Availability The removal of the 128 GB storage option results in a higher starting price for the Pixel 10 Pro XL. While this may deter budget-conscious buyers, the expanded features and improved specifications justify the increase for those seeking a premium smartphone experience. Pricing varies by region, but the Pixel 10 Pro XL is positioned as a flagship offering in Google's lineup, appealing to users who prioritize innovative technology and performance. Final Thoughts The Google Pixel 10 Pro XL combines meaningful upgrades with incremental improvements to deliver a well-rounded flagship smartphone. From the advanced ProRes zoom and Magic Q assistant to the larger battery and enhanced display, this device caters to a wide range of users. Whether you're a photography enthusiast, a tech-savvy individual, or someone seeking a reliable and feature-rich smartphone, the Pixel 10 Pro XL offers a compelling package. Its success ultimately depends on how well these features integrate into your daily life, but it undoubtedly sets a new standard for Google's Pixel lineup. Why is Zelenskyy bringing a posse of European leaders to the US for peace talks?

The president of the European Commission has confirmed she will join the meeting between Donald Trump and Volodymyr Zelenskyy in Washington. Ursula von der Leyen said she will join the talk "at the request of President Zelenskyy", adding that she "and other European leaders" will be meeting at the White House on Monday. Also set to join in are German Chancellor Friedrich Merz, Italy's Prime Minister Giorgia Meloni and Finnish President Alexander Stubb, Mr Stubb's friendship with Mr Trump is said to have blossomed since the pair bonded over their love of golf during a tournament at Mar-a-Lago in March. Mr Stubb, whose attendance at the Washington meeting hasn't been officially confirmed yet, previously said that Mr Trump is " the only person who can broker a peace" deal, saying the US president was "the only one that Putin is afraid of". Bringing Ms von der Leyen and Mr Stubb along to the meeting could be an attempt by Mr Zelenskyy to prevent another version of the infamous Oval Office showdown with Mr Trump and the vice-president, JD Vance, in the Oval Office this February. They were set to discuss a potential ceasefire with Russia and a mineral deal between Ukraine and the US, but their meeting descended into chaos when a fiery shouting match unfolded in front of media representatives. Mr Trump and his second-in-command, Mr Vance, ambushed the Ukrainian president, mocking him for not wearing a suit and telling him he didn't "have the cards right now with us". The disastrous meeting ended with Mr Zelenskyy prematurely leaving the White House. He later said the bust-up was "not good for both sides". At the US-Russia summit on Friday, Mr Trump (quite literally) rolled out the red carpet for Mr Putin and even let the Russian leader take a ride with him in the presidential limousine dubbed The Beast. Mr Zelenskyy is set for a less warm welcome, with no red carpet or fly past, no round of applause, according to Sky News' US correspondent Martha Kelner. The atmosphere may get friendlier with leaders like Ms von der Leyen and Mr Stubb in Mr Zelenskyy's corner, and the inclusion of the European leaders as mediators could help prevent a repeat of the Oval Office clash. Mr Stubb has repeatedly voiced support for Ukraine, and Finland, along with other Nordic countries and the three Baltic states, has been among the country's staunchest supporters. The 2022 invasion prompted Finland, which shares a 1,340-km (833-mile) border with Russia, to join NATO two years ago, upending decades of non-alignment. Two days before the Alaska summit, Mr Zelenskyy, Mr Trump and European leaders, including Mr Stubb, were on a conference call, after which the Finnish leader wrote on X: "Excellent meeting with @Potus and European leaders, including @ZelenskyyUA. Aligned views and unity. "We are working together for a ceasefire and a sustainable peace. We are there for Ukraine every step of the way. The next few days and weeks can be decisive."

iOS 26 Beta 7 and Public Beta 4 are COMING... Here's What to Expect

Apple's iOS 26 is shaping up to be a significant update, with Developer Beta 7 and Public Beta 4 expected to roll out soon. These beta versions provide a glimpse into the new features, system enhancements, and visual upgrades that will define the final release, anticipated in mid-September 2025. With a focus on improving functionality, performance, and user experience, iOS 26 promises to deliver a more refined and engaging interaction with Apple devices. Below is an in-depth look at the most notable updates and what they mean for users in a new video from iDeviceHelp. Watch this video on YouTube. Live Translation for AirPods: A Innovative Feature One of the most exciting additions in iOS 26 is the introduction of live translation for AirPods. This feature, designed specifically for AirPods Pro 2 and the upcoming 4th-generation AirPods, enables real-time language translation directly through your earbuds. Whether you're traveling abroad or engaging in multilingual conversations, this functionality eliminates the need for separate translation devices. By simply wearing your AirPods, you can seamlessly understand and communicate in foreign languages. Although still in development, this feature is expected to appear in future beta firmware updates, marking a significant step forward in multilingual communication and accessibility. AI-Powered Voice Control for Siri Siri is undergoing a fantastic upgrade with the integration of advanced on-device AI. This enhancement allows Siri to process commands locally on your device, resulting in faster response times and improved privacy. The AI is designed to distinguish between casual conversations and direct commands, making interactions with Siri more intuitive and efficient. This feature not only enhances hands-free navigation but also underscores Apple's commitment to using AI for practical, user-focused improvements. While this capability won't be available in the initial beta releases, its inclusion in iOS 26 highlights Apple's dedication to advancing voice assistant technology. Smoother Animations and System Refinements iOS 26 introduces a series of subtle yet impactful refinements to system animations. From app transitions to Control Center interactions, these updates are designed to make your device feel more responsive and polished. The improved animations contribute to a smoother, more fluid user experience, enhancing the overall usability of your iPhone. While these changes may not be immediately noticeable, they play a crucial role in creating a seamless and enjoyable interface, reflecting Apple's attention to detail in optimizing everyday interactions. Standby Mode: Enhanced Visual Appeal Standby Mode is receiving a significant visual upgrade with the addition of liquid glass effects. This dynamic feature enhances the aesthetic appeal of your device when it's idle, transforming it into a visually striking display. Whether you're using Standby Mode as a bedside clock, a digital photo frame, or a functional dashboard, the liquid glass effects add a layer of sophistication and immersion. This update not only improves the visual experience but also reinforces Apple's focus on blending functionality with design. Release Timeline and Expectations The release schedule for iOS 26 is becoming increasingly clear. Developer Beta 7 is expected to arrive on August 18, 2025, with Public Beta 4 following shortly after. These beta versions provide developers and early adopters with the opportunity to explore new features and offer valuable feedback. Apple is targeting mid-September 2025—likely around September 15—for the official launch of iOS 26. This timeline aligns with the anticipated announcement of new hardware, making it a pivotal moment for Apple's ecosystem. What These Updates Mean for You The updates in iOS 26 reflect Apple's ongoing commitment to enhancing the user experience across its devices. Whether you're drawn to the new live translation feature for AirPods, intrigued by Siri's on-device AI capabilities, or excited about the smoother animations and visual upgrades, these changes are designed to make your interactions with Apple devices more intuitive and enjoyable. As beta testing progresses, additional insights will emerge, offering a clearer understanding of how these features will shape the final release of iOS 26.
